    Abstract: A conveyance chain comprises a plurality of link plates alternately coupled and conveying plural tool pots each holding a tool. The plurality of link plates include an inner link plate and an outer link plate each including a rotation stop hole that stops a rotation of the tool pot and a rotation permit hole located upstream from the rotation stop hole with respect to a conveyance direction that permits a rotation of the tool pot. The plurality of tool pots includes a first tool pot and a second tool pot, the first tool pot is inserted through a rotation stop hole of the inner link plate and a rotation permit hole of the outer link plate, and adjacent to the first tool pot, the second tool pot is inserted through a rotation permit hole of the inner link plate and a rotation stop hole of the outer link plate.

    Abstract: A chain-type tool magazine includes a main body, a track, a chain, and a driving mechanism. The track is coupled to the mounting surface of the main body and provides a running route which includes a physical support segment and at least one vacant running segment. The chain is formed by a plurality of tool chains connected in series and is driven by the driving mechanism to run around the running route. When each of the tool chains of the chain passes through the physical support segment, each of the tool chains is in contact with the physical support segment. When each of the tool chains of the chain passes through the vacant running segment, each of the tool chains is not in contact with the track. With a discontinuous broken-track type design of the track, the cost can be reduced.

    Abstract: A rotating tool pot chain is capable of bending in both directions, the tool pot sweeps a relatively small area as it rotates, and the chain is capable of holding the tool pot stably. A pair of inner link plates (23) and a pair of outer link plates (24), are formed with openings to provide tool pot storage areas (23a, 24a) so that the tool pot, when stored, is parallel direction with the adjacent link connection pins 26. The center of each tool pot storage area (23a, 24a) is located on a chain pitch line passing through the centers of the adjacent connection pins 26. Further, the fulcrum (support pin 50) on which the tool pot 42 rotates is below the level of the adjacent connection pins 26 but above the bottoms of the tool pot storage areas (23a, 24a).

    Abstract: A tool pot separation type chain for use in a tool magazine includes a plurality of tool pots, and a plurality of pairs of laterally spaced link plates each adjacent ones of which are connected to each other by a connection pin. Each of the pairs of link plates has a tool pot receiving section for removably receiving one of the tool pots therein. Each of the tool pots has a pair of bearings mounted thereon such that outer races of the bearings are movable in rolling contact on a guide rail or a tool pot jumping-out preventing rail provided in an opposing relationship with the guide rail in the tool magazine. With this construction, the tool pot separation type chain is able to minimizes the traveling resistance thereof during carrying of the tool pots to reduce the driving force, prevent abrasion of the tool pots and the rails and suppress generation of noise and also facilitates a carrying in or carrying out operation of each tool pot at a tool pot loading/unloading position.

    Abstract: The invention concerns a chain magazine designed to hold the machining tools for machining devices, in particular tooling machines. The magazine comprises a continuous chain fitted with holder devices for the machining tools and driven by at least two sprockets and guided by guide elements up to the point of contact with the pitch diameter of the drive or guide sprocket wheel. The chain magazine further comprises chain links consisting of a connecting bar and, joined to the bar, two tubular sleeve elements of different diameter which form the flexible couplings between the links. Holder devices for machining tools are disposed coaxially to the hinge axes in the mutually encircling tubular sleeves under a small motion clearance. Shaft-like cutouts are furnished in each of the tubular sleeves and exhibiting parallel faces disposed spaced apart and directed toward the center axes of the holder devices.
